MATERIALS FOAM CORE BOARD 1/2” and 3/16” SCRAP BOOK PAPER JEWELRY CHAIN U-SHAPED BOBBY PINS CHALK OR ACRYLIC PAINT TWINE or JUTE 1” JUMP RING HOT GLUE GUN HOT GLUE X-ACTO KNIFE and BLADES TACKY GLUE SKEWER WIRE CUTTERS E600 (optional) INSTRUCTIONS STEP 1 Cut 2 pattern pieces out of foam core board as shown on pattern pieces. Using your x-acto knife. STEP 2 Glue scrapbook paper (I used tacky glue) to each piece and trim. I covered both sides. Glue a skewer piece into the wing and body of the bird (used hot glue for this). Shown on page 4. STEP 3 Paint edges including skewer. STEP 4 Wrap twine or jute around the ring-shaped piece. Secure with glue at the beginning and end (I used tacky glue). STEP 5 Follow assembly instructions on page 4. All of my projects are made with items I have. Feel free to sub out materials for what you have. Project ideas are for inspiration.
